Industry Trends

The oil and gas industry is experiencing unprecedented regulatory pressure to reduce methane emissions and improve environmental compliance, creating substantial demand for advanced emissions control technologies and driving significant capital investments in upstream facilities. The EPA's recent strengthening of methane emission standards and state-level regulations are forcing operators to rapidly adopt new technologies, creating a robust market for emissions management solutions. Digital transformation and Industry 4.0 technologies are revolutionizing upstream operations, with operators increasingly seeking integrated solutions that combine emissions control with real-time monitoring, predictive analytics, and automated compliance reporting. This trend is driving demand for sophisticated business development professionals who can articulate complex technical value propositions. The energy transition is creating a dual market dynamic where traditional oil and gas operators are simultaneously investing in emissions reduction technologies to maintain social license while exploring carbon capture and renewable energy integration opportunities, requiring business development expertise that spans multiple technology domains.

Company Overview

HOERBIGER

HOERBIGER is a well-established Austrian industrial technology company with over 130 years of history, specializing in compression technology, drive technology, and safety solutions for energy and automotive industries. The company has built a strong reputation as a technology innovator with significant investment in research and development, maintaining a global presence with manufacturing and service capabilities across multiple continents.

HOERBIGER holds a strong market position as a specialized technology provider in niche industrial markets, competing effectively with larger conglomerates through technical expertise and customer service excellence. The company's focus on emissions and compression technologies positions it well in the current regulatory and environmental compliance landscape.
